The child protection law provides its own interpretation, which is part of the law of children in Indonesia starting from civil rights, parenting, guardianship, adoption, exploitation of children in the economic, social and sexual fields. On the other hand, the punishment for adults that committing crimes on children are the responsibility of parents, the community and the state in protecting children. However, the legal coverage of the child is very broad and cannot be simplified into the field of legal violations committed by children. Due to the number of child protection regulations, it is necessary to compile legislation by state agencies that have authority. A study is also needed to see the harmonization between legislation in Islamic law (Fiqh). Thus, there can be seen gaps and legal vacancies that occur.
